License Plate Readers to be Introduced at Sorpa Waste Stations in Iceland
Sorpa, the waste management company in the capital area of Iceland, will implement license plate readers at its reception stations starting March 1st. The system aims to analyze customer groups, simplify processes, and charge customers, but is expected to affect only a quarter of residents.
